This has been asked before, but with the rising costs, how are the shooting costs at your club holding out? Since I stated shooting skeet a few weeks ago, I have been shooting like crazy. Wednesdays, Saturdays and Sundays, I go out to the club and I have been shooting 3-4 rounds of skeet a day. (I'm really having a blast!) Our club will be raising the price of shooting trap, skeet and sporting clays August the first. I don't know what sporting clays will be but I know trap and skeet will go up to $4.00 a round, which still isn't too bad compared to some clubs. We have a special deal where you can by a punch card and get 10 rounds for $37.50, (or a $20.00 for $75.00) but you have to be a member to buy one. So, that is still only $3.75 a round. Not too bad. I shoot at the Middletown Sportsmans Club, by the way, and you can find our website by typing in the name on Yahoo. So, how are the prices at your club holding out?

Our club in Memphis Tn. is member owned and has a manager and about 4 paid workers on duty 7 days a week...we probably have close to 3000 members and it's one of the nicest ranges in the country.

All our machines have electronic counters.
Trap, Skeet and Wobble Trap is .13 cents a target or $3.25 per 25 rounds...5 stand and Sporting clay comes to about .20 cents a target or $20 bucks per hundred.
You can get by alittle cheaper if you rent/buy a preset counter.

We(Purgatory Clay Sports) charge non-members $5 for trap, skeet and 5-stand and 12.50 for 50 sporting clays. Members pay $4.50 and $12.00. Members can also buy a punch card for $100 that contains $115 in punches, making the net cost $4.37 and $10.87.
Cedar City charges $4.00 and $3.50 for trap(non-members and members). Kanab is the same. Both offer punch cards tht further reduce the cost.
Membership in all three clubs is $25, per year.

We also have no payroll, rent or utilities.

Amarillo Gun Club member prices are:
Annual memebership $125
Trap and Skeet - $5
Five Stand $7

We have had some money problems and until I read this thread I assumed we weren't charging enough. We have paid trappers (kids). We don't have a paid managager which I am not sure saves any money. I called Silverleaf in Oklahoma and Windwalker in Midland and the San Angelo club and they were all a couple of dollars per round higher.
